//===--- BareMetal.h - Bare Metal Tool and ToolChain ------------*- C++-*-===//
//
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
// See https://llvm.org/LICENSE.txt for license information.
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
//
//===----------------------------------------------------------------------===//
#ifndef LLVM_CLANG_LIB_DRIVER_TOOLCHAINS_BAREMETAL_H
#define LLVM_CLANG_LIB_DRIVER_TOOLCHAINS_BAREMETAL_H
#include "clang/Driver/Tool.h"
#include "clang/Driver/ToolChain.h"
#include <string>
namespace clang {
namespace driver {
namespace toolchains {
class LLVM_LIBRARY_VISIBILITY BareMetal : public ToolChain {
public:
BareMetal(const Driver &D, const llvm::Triple &Triple,
const llvm::opt::ArgList &Args);
~BareMetal() override = default;
static bool handlesTarget(const llvm::Triple &Triple);
void findMultilibs(const Driver &D, const llvm::Triple &Triple,
const llvm::opt::ArgList &Args);
protected:
Tool *buildLinker() const override;
Tool *buildStaticLibTool() const override;
public:
bool useIntegratedAs() const override { return true; }
bool isBareMetal() const override { return true; }
bool isCrossCompiling() const override { return true; }
bool HasNativeLLVMSupport() const override { return true; }
bool isPICDefault() const override { return false; }
bool isPIEDefault(const llvm::opt::ArgList &Args) const override {
return false;
}
bool isPICDefaultForced() const override { return false; }
bool SupportsProfiling() const override { return false; }
StringRef getOSLibName() const override { return "baremetal"; }
RuntimeLibType GetDefaultRuntimeLibType() const override {
return ToolChain::RLT_CompilerRT;
}
CXXStdlibType GetDefaultCXXStdlibType() const override {
return ToolChain::CST_Libcxx;
}
const char *getDefaultLinker() const override { return "ld.lld"; }
void
AddClangSystemIncludeArgs(const llvm::opt::ArgList &DriverArgs,
llvm::opt::ArgStringList &CC1Args) const override;
void
addClangTargetOptions(const llvm::opt::ArgList &DriverArgs,
llvm::opt::ArgStringList &CC1Args,
Action::OffloadKind DeviceOffloadKind) const override;
void AddClangCXXStdlibIncludeArgs(
const llvm::opt::ArgList &DriverArgs,
llvm::opt::ArgStringList &CC1Args) const override;
void AddCXXStdlibLibArgs(const llvm::opt::ArgList &Args,
llvm::opt::ArgStringList &CmdArgs) const override;
void AddLinkRuntimeLib(const llvm::opt::ArgList &Args,
llvm::opt::ArgStringList &CmdArgs) const;
std::string computeSysRoot() const override;
SanitizerMask getSupportedSanitizers() const override;
private:
using OrderedMultilibs =
llvm::iterator_range<llvm::SmallVector<Multilib>::const_reverse_iterator>;
OrderedMultilibs getOrderedMultilibs() const;
};
} // namespace toolchains
namespace tools {
namespace baremetal {
class LLVM_LIBRARY_VISIBILITY StaticLibTool : public Tool {
public:
StaticLibTool(const ToolChain &TC)
: Tool("baremetal::StaticLibTool", "llvm-ar", TC) {}
bool hasIntegratedCPP() const override { return false; }
bool isLinkJob() const override { return true; }
void ConstructJob(Compilation &C, const JobAction &JA,
const InputInfo &Output, const InputInfoList &Inputs,
const llvm::opt::ArgList &TCArgs,
const char *LinkingOutput) const override;
};
class LLVM_LIBRARY_VISIBILITY Linker final : public Tool {
public:
Linker(const ToolChain &TC) : Tool("baremetal::Linker", "ld.lld", TC) {}
bool isLinkJob() const override { return true; }
bool hasIntegratedCPP() const override { return false; }
void ConstructJob(Compilation &C, const JobAction &JA,
const InputInfo &Output, const InputInfoList &Inputs,
const llvm::opt::ArgList &TCArgs,
const char *LinkingOutput) const override;
};
} // namespace baremetal
} // namespace tools
} // namespace driver
} // namespace clang
#endif
